Web制作を始めると、「CSSを自分で書いた方がいいの?」「Bootstrapを使う方が早い?」と迷う方は多いでしょう。
どちらにもメリット・デメリットがあり、目的やスキルレベルによって最適な選択が異なります。
この記事では、自作CSSとBootstrapの違いを初心者にもわかりやすく解説し、どんなケースでどちらを選ぶべきかを紹介します。

自分でCSSを書くメリットとデメリット
Bootstrapを使うメリット
Bootstrapは、あらかじめデザインが整ったCSSフレームワークです。クラスを指定するだけで、レスポンシブ対応デザインを簡単に実装できます。
また、ボタン・フォーム・ナビバーなどのUIコンポーネントが充実しており、開発スピードを大幅に向上できます。
CSS関連記事はこちら👉【CSS入門】セレクタ(selector)とは?初心者にもわかりやすい3つの基本(タグ・クラス・ID)を解説
Bootstrapを使うデメリット
Bootstrapは便利な反面、デザインが似通いやすいというデメリットがあります。カスタマイズしないままだと、「Bootstrapっぽい」見た目になり、オリジナリティが欠けます。
また、不要なCSSやJSが読み込まれるため、ファイルが重くなるケースもあります。
公式サイトはこちら👉Bootstrapで高速で
レスポンシブなサイトを構築しよう
どちらを使うべき?目的別の選び方
学習目的なら自分でCSSを書く
CSSの基礎を学びたい人には、自分でCSSを書くのがおすすめです。コードの仕組みや優先順位(カスケード)を理解できることで、今後のスキルアップにつながります。
効率重視ならBootstrapを活用
短期間でサイトを作りたい、またはチーム開発で共通デザインを使いたい場合はBootstrapが最適です。統一感があり、すぐに実用的なデザインを作れます。
Summary
自分でCSSを書くのとBootstrapを使うのは、どちらが優れているという問題ではなく、目的によって使い分けるのがポイントです。
・学習・自由度を重視するなら自作CSS、スピードと効率を重視するならBootstrap。
・両方の特性を理解して、自分の制作スタイルに合った方法を選びましょう。

Comments